OpenAI’s Next Leap: What to Expect from GPT-5

Artificial intelligence is evolving at an astonishing rate, and OpenAI is once again at the forefront of innovation. The company, led by CEO Sam Altman, has revealed exciting details about its next-generation AI models, with a particular focus on GPT-5. OpenAI’s roadmap points towards a smarter, more cohesive system that aims to enhance user experience and simplify AI interactions.

The journey towards GPT-5 begins with an intermediate step—GPT-4.5. Codenamed “Orion,” GPT-4.5 is expected to be OpenAI’s last model that does not heavily integrate chain-of-thought reasoning. However, the real breakthrough will come with GPT-5, which represents a shift towards a more unified approach in AI development. Unlike previous iterations, GPT-5 will merge different AI model series, such as the O-series and GPT-series, into a single, intelligent system capable of handling a variety of tasks effortlessly.

OpenAI has been laying the groundwork for this evolution for months. In late 2024, the company introduced its experimental o3 model, followed by the release of o3-mini in early 2025. These smaller models provided glimpses into OpenAI’s long-term vision—one where AI is more intuitive, adaptable, and efficient without requiring users to choose between different model versions.

One of the most significant challenges OpenAI seeks to address is the complexity of having multiple AI models. Currently, users must decide which model best fits their needs, sometimes switching between versions to optimize performance. Altman has acknowledged this issue, expressing OpenAI’s commitment to providing a “magic unified intelligence” that eliminates the need for manual selection. GPT-5 is designed to smartly determine when to engage in deeper reasoning, utilize the right tools, and assist users with minimal friction, making AI interaction more seamless than ever.

OpenAI has also outlined a structured rollout plan for GPT-5. Free-tier ChatGPT users will continue to have access to AI at a foundational level, while Plus subscribers will benefit from enhanced capabilities. Meanwhile, Pro subscribers will gain access to OpenAI’s most advanced intelligence, promising superior performance across tasks. While exact release dates remain undisclosed, Altman hinted that both GPT-4.5 and GPT-5 could arrive in the months following February 2025.

In an unexpected twist, Elon Musk has entered the scene with a staggering $97.4 billion offer to acquire OpenAI’s nonprofit arm. Musk, a well-known figure in the AI space and an early supporter of OpenAI, has frequently shared his concerns about AI’s rapid development. His offer signals a strong desire to influence OpenAI’s trajectory. However, the company’s board is reportedly set to reject the bid, leaving speculation about Musk’s next move. Given the financial stakes involved, this situation is far from over and may lead to further developments in the near future.

Looking beyond GPT-5, OpenAI continues to push the boundaries of AI advancement. The company has already set its sights on releasing another major AI model by December 2025, further cementing its shift towards a unified AI system. Instead of maintaining separate models, OpenAI aims to refine its AI into a single, adaptive system capable of understanding and assisting users more effectively than ever before.
